The new berserk effects are tied to leveling (level 52 and 58 i think for the 3cp shred crits and the 2cp refunds on 5cp finishers).

When Berserk is up shred non crit gives 2cp and shred crit gives 3cp in addition do dealing extra damage. Brutal Slash despite costing less still gives 1cp non crit, 2cp crit.

At the moment this causes the gameplay of:
Using only shred as generator since it deals more damage than brutal slash (stealth + cp bonus).
Since there is a lack of energy its basically:

  1. wait for clearcasting then push shred
  2. push your finisher (usually ferocious bite) if it crits
  3. Rake/BrS/Moonfire if you need the 5th CP.
    if you go from 2cp to 4cp (shred non crit), then you use empowered rake.
    There’s pretty much no ability to proc bloodtalons as you are only casting shred/rake+finisher and you don’t have the energy to cast anything else, you’re basically sacking a 3rd finisher for 30% on two finishers so you would just cast the 3rd finisher.
    night fae ability is one trigger to get your energy back up + restore bloodtalons stacks which makes it quite strong.
    Might have some 4cp finisher (rip/SR) play during berserk (still thinking about it).

Leaving PvP aside for a moment, but we had this already in BFA when Sabertooth effectively made Rip’s duration infinite. While no one can doubt its effectiveness, (it was the top talent by a country mile for the entirety of the expac both in PvP and in raid) it made for perhaps the most boring iteration of Feral I’ve ever played. I want there to be room for error in the way I use my combo points. If the only correct answer to my combo point spending abilities is Bite that doesn’t make for particularly interesting gameplay. Especially for a spec that gets most of its nuance and complexity from managing bleed snapshots and pandemic timers.
